What you can expect
Explore the Château de Vascœuil, a Centre for Art and History located in Normandy, just 20 km from Rouen. Listed in the Supplementary Inventory of Historic Monuments and labelled a “Destination of Excellence” by the Ministry of Tourism, this 5-hectare estate welcomes between 25,000 and 30,000 visitors each year who come to admire its architectural, botanical, and artistic heritage.
Your “Visite Globale” ticket gives you access to the entire estate: the dovecote, the castle, the temporary exhibitions, the Jules Michelet Museum, and the gardens.
The route first takes you to the gardens, the true jewel of the estate since 1774, when the owner Charles Delavigne had Caresme draw up the first landscape plan. Here, you will discover a classic “French-style” garden, with its parterres and box trees pruned to perfection close to the château, and a more romantic “English-style” garden towards the museum and the waterfall, where Norman species (oaks, beeches, yews, maples) stand alongside exotic species such as Atlas cedars and imperial paulownias. The park is home to a majestic centuries-old oak tree and an exceptional permanent collection of more than 50 original sculptures (bronzes, marbles, mosaics, ceramics) by Dalí, Braque, Cocteau, Vasarely, Volti, Carzou, Fernand Léger, and Chemiakin.
The tour continues with the Jules Michelet Museum, dedicated to the historian (1798–1874) who stayed in Vascœuil several times and wrote there in his study, located in the 12th-century octagonal tower, which has now been faithfully reconstructed.
Since 1970, the castle has also presented, from mid-March to mid-November, three major temporary exhibitions (spring, summer, fall) dedicated to renowned modern and contemporary artists, like the previous exhibitions of Bernard Buffet, Dalí, Mathieu, Folon, Kijno, Carzou, Paul Delvaux, and Cocteau.
At the moment, until October 18, 2026, the castle is paying tribute to Pierre Yves Trémois (1921–2020), an artist whose work is showcased in the estate's exhibition halls. The 2026 cultural calendar also includes the 2nd Ceramics Biennial and the “Dentelles Nomades” exhibition, as well as events such as Heritage Day (September 19-20) and the traditional “Magie des Orchidées” at the end of October.
